Television monitors, also referred to as TV screens, are vital components in a modern-day home entertainment setup. But did you know that there are several synonyms to describe these electronic displays? One common term is "television set," which describes the entire apparatus including the screen, speakers, and its support structure. Other synonyms for a TV monitor include "display screen," "video monitor," or "flat-screen display." Depending on the context, a TV screen can also be called a "home theater display" or a "visual display unit," especially when used for gaming purposes. While there are several terms to describe TV monitors, they all share the same functionality - to provide viewers with high-quality visual entertainment.
